摘要:
The presence of organic coatings in soils may considerably modify the ability of minerals to immobilize nutrient cations. Based on the preparation of montmorillonite-humic acid complexes (MH), we examined the changes in major properties of montmorillonite (Mt) before and after humic acid (HA) coating, and evaluated the influence of these differences on the behavior of ammonium (NH4+) and potassium (K+) ions on Mt by batch experiments. HA coating glued clay particles together, and significantly decreased the cation exchange capacity and specific surface area. An HA coating significantly increased the retention capacity of Mt for NH4+ and K+, and enhanced the selectivity for NH4+ over K+. Kinetic studies showed a more rapid adsorption rate and slower fixation rate for both cations, especially for NH4+, after HA coating. An HA coating changed mainly the surface properties of Mt and consequently increased the retention competitiveness of NH4+ on Mt.
